View original image[Asia Economy Reporter Lee Gwan-joo] Jeong Eun-kyung, former Commissioner of the Korea Disease Control and Prevention Agency, has been appointed as an Infectious Disease Policy Research Committee member at Bundang Seoul National University Hospital.
According to the Government Officials Ethics Committee and Bundang Seoul National University Hospital on the 7th, Jeong, after passing the employment review for retired public officials, was approved for short-term special professional employment at Bundang Seoul National University Hospital and started working from the 4th of this month.
Jeong’s position is known to be an Infectious Disease Policy Research Committee member. It is a one-year special professional position, and she reportedly applied and was accepted through the recruitment announcement in August. Jeong retired from her post as Commissioner of the Disease Control and Prevention Agency on May 17.

Bundang Seoul National University Hospital was finally selected in March this year in the metropolitan infectious disease specialized hospital contest conducted by the Disease Control and Prevention Agency. The scale of the infectious disease specialized hospital is a total floor area of 88,097㎡, with 6 basement floors and 9 above-ground floors, totaling 342 beds. The goal is to complete construction by December 2027, and if established as planned, it is expected to become the largest infectious disease specialized hospital in Korea.
